Do Horses Sleep Upright . They possess a unique ability to lock their own limbs, specifically their rear kneecaps, into place, allowing their skeleton to hold itself upright without engaging the muscles. When standing, they will typically position their heads and necks below the withers for comfort while resting. Horses have a group of muscles called a stay apparatus that keeps them upright while. The horse can then relax and nap without worrying about falling. By sleeping in an upright position, horses can quickly escape from predators if needed.
